VOLVO V70 2006 User Guide Seat adjustment 
Adjust the power seat(s) with the controls at the side of the seat as follows: 
1 Front edge of seat (raise/lower) 
2 Forward - rearward 
3 Rear edge of seat (raise/lower) 
4 Backrest

VOLVO V70 2006 User Guide Side marker light 
1. Turn  the lamp holder counterclockwise and  pull it out. 
2. Pull out the defective bulb and  insert a  new one.
